Output 7cbf95afc8263ad33a6aeba95ea36404a15caf5f7181a0b559ed8979fa4b37cb:0

value
87691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7b13b54d8636edfb78ad84d583fd5044bfe80e6 OP_EQUAL
address
3KtthzmXUuwxvLeaq1SoRBZzTmiMj2dFk9
transaction
7cbf95afc8263ad33a6aeba95ea36404a15caf5f7181a0b559ed8979fa4b37cb
spent
true